PlayStation Vita’s Japanese launch started off well, with close to 325,000 units sold in its first week. That hasn’t been the case in recent weeks, though, with sales figures dropping to just over 72,000 in its second week and fewer … Continue reading

Gamers can expect a lengthy experience with Uncharted on PlayStation Vita. The campaign found in Sony Bend’s Uncharted: Golden Abyss will last over 10 hours, director John Garvin has revealed in an interview with NowGamer. That, for some, is a … Continue reading
